What is the Child Enrollment Agreement?
The Child Enrollment Agreement is a crucial document used by The PREP School of McKinney to collect essential information about a child. This form entails details such as personal information, emergency contacts, and various consents necessary for enrollment. By completing this school enrollment form, parents or legal guardians ensure that the school has accurate data to meet their child’s needs.

Required Information for the Child Enrollment Agreement
When filling out the Child Enrollment Agreement, specific fields must be accurately completed. These include:
-
Child’s full name
-
Child’s date of birth
-
Parent’s or guardian’s information
-
Emergency contacts
-
Consents and medical authorizations
Ensuring that each section is filled out correctly is vital to avoid delays in processing the enrollment.

Who is eligible to fill out the Child Enrollment Agreement?
The Child Enrollment Agreement must be completed by a parent or legal guardian of the child being enrolled in The PREP School of McKinney.
What information is needed to complete this form?
You will need the child’s full name, date of birth, personal details of the parent or guardian, emergency contacts, and any medical authorizations before starting the agreement.
